Wood window replacement services involve removing old, worn, or damaged wooden windows and installing new, high-quality units. This process typically includes measuring window openings, selecting appropriate replacement styles, and carefully installing the new windows to ensure proper fit and function. Skilled contractors can also handle any necessary repairs to the surrounding framing or sills to create a secure and level installation. Replacing wood windows can improve the appearance of a property while enhancing energy efficiency and overall comfort.
Many property owners turn to wood window replacement to address specific problems such as dr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, or visible signs of rot and decay. Over time, wooden frames can deteriorate due to moisture exposure, leading to leaks, increased energy costs, and potential structural issues. Replacing these windows helps eliminate drafts, reduce noise infiltration, and prevent further damage caused by moisture. It also offers an opportunity to upgrade to more modern, durable window designs that require less maintenance.

Deciding when to replace wood windows depends on several factors, such as visible damage, difficulty with operation, or increasing energy bills. If windows are showing signs of rot, warping, or excessive peeling paint, replacement can restore both the appearance and performance of the property. Replacing windows can also be beneficial when older units no longer meet current energy efficiency standards, leading to higher heating and cooling costs. The overview below groups typical Wood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in North Branch, MN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or wood window repairs in North Branch range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ing rotted sashes or hardware, fall within this range. Fewer projects reach the higher end unless additional work is needed.
Standard Replacement - Full wood window replacements usually cost between $1,200 and $3,000 per window, depending on size and style. Most homeowners in the area find their projects land in this middle range, with some larger or custom jobs exceeding $3,500.
Full Home Upgrade - Replacing all windows in a typical North Branch home can range from $10,000 to $25,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ects or homes with custom features tend to push costs higher, often into the $30,000+ range.
High-End or Custom Projects - Custom wood windows or extensive renovations can reach $5,000 or more per window, especially for larger, ornate designs. Many such projects are less common, but they represent the upper tier of potential costs for premium work by local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
